Understanding Window Types, Materials, and Quality Factors

A quick look at window types, materials, and what actually affects quality reveals a wide array of options designed to meet various aesthetic and functional needs. Common window types include single-hung, double-hung, casement, awning, slider, and picture windows, each offering distinct operational benefits and ventilation capabilities. The choice often depends on the room’s function, desired airflow, and architectural style. For instance, casement windows offer excellent ventilation and a tight seal, while picture windows maximize natural light.

Materials play a significant role in a window’s durability, maintenance, and thermal performance. Vinyl windows are popular for their affordability, low maintenance, and good insulation properties. Wood windows offer a classic aesthetic and natural insulation but require more maintenance. Fiberglass provides strength, durability, and energy efficiency, resisting warping and rotting. Aluminum windows are strong and slim, often chosen for modern designs, though they typically offer less insulation than other materials unless thermally broken. The quality of a window is not just about the frame material, but also the glass package, hardware, and overall construction, which contribute to its longevity and performance.

Exploring Energy-Efficient Window Features for Home Comfort

A simple breakdown of energy-efficient windows and how they can help your home feel more comfortable highlights several key features. The glass package is central to a window’s energy performance. Double-pane or triple-pane glass creates insulating airspaces. These spaces are often filled with inert gases like argon or krypton, which are denser than air and further reduce heat transfer. Low-emissivity (Low-E) coatings are microscopic, transparent metal layers applied to the glass surface that reflect infrared light, keeping heat inside during winter and outside during summer, without significantly impacting visible light.

Beyond the glass, the frame material itself contributes to energy efficiency. Materials like vinyl and fiberglass have inherent insulating properties. Additionally, features like warm-edge spacers, which separate the panes of glass, reduce heat transfer at the edge of the glass unit. Properly sealed frames and sashes prevent air leakage, a common source of energy loss. By minimizing drafts and regulating indoor temperatures more effectively, energy-efficient windows contribute to a more consistent and comfortable indoor environment while potentially lowering heating and cooling costs.

Key Comparisons Before Choosing Replacement Windows

Thinking about replacing your windows? Here’s what to compare before choosing to ensure you make an informed decision. Start by evaluating the U-factor, which measures how well a window prevents heat from escaping your home; a lower U-factor indicates better insulation. The Solar Heat Gain Coefficient (SHGC) indicates how well a window blocks heat caused by sunlight; a lower SHGC is beneficial in warmer climates to reduce cooling loads. Visible Transmittance (VT) measures how much visible light passes through the window, impacting natural illumination.

Beyond performance ratings, compare warranties offered by different manufacturers. A strong warranty can provide peace of mind regarding product defects and long-term performance. Aesthetics are also crucial; consider how the window style, frame color, and grid patterns will complement your home’s architecture. Finally, compare installation methods and the reputation of installers. Proper installation is as critical as the window’s quality for achieving optimal performance and longevity. The Window Installation and Maintenance Journey

From installation to maintenance — easy tips for understanding the whole process can help homeowners prepare and protect their investment. Professional installation is vital for new windows to perform as intended. This involves precise measurements, proper sealing, and ensuring the window is plumb, level, and square within its opening. A poorly installed window can negate the benefits of even the most energy-efficient product, leading to drafts, moisture intrusion, and operational issues. Reputable installers often provide detailed timelines and explain their process, including how they protect your home during the work and clean up afterward.

Once installed, routine maintenance helps extend the life and performance of your windows. This typically includes cleaning the glass with appropriate solutions, inspecting seals and weatherstripping for wear, and ensuring moving parts operate smoothly. Lubricating hinges and tracks on casement or slider windows can prevent stiffness. Addressing any minor issues promptly, such as small cracks in sealant, can prevent larger problems down the line. Following manufacturer guidelines for care will help maintain the warranty and the window’s aesthetic appeal for many years.

Cost Considerations for New Window Projects

Curious what to look for in new windows, including the financial aspect? This guide covers the basics in plain language, acknowledging that costs can vary significantly. The overall expense of a new window project depends on several factors: the type of window chosen, the frame material, the glass package (e.g., double-pane, Low-E, argon gas), the size and number of windows, and the complexity of the installation. Custom sizes or historically accurate designs typically cost more than standard options. Installation labor costs also vary based on regional rates and the specific challenges of your home’s construction.

Understanding these variables helps in budgeting for your project. While the initial investment might seem substantial, new windows can offer long-term benefits through improved energy efficiency, enhanced curb appeal, and increased home value. It’s advisable to obtain multiple quotes from different providers to compare not only prices but also the scope of work, warranty details, and estimated timelines.
